Hi, When I was using Panda theme and Stickers block I came across a problem.
In configuration of Stickers block module you can associate sticker to specified products.
This form is unconvenient when adding to multiple products because you have to add one product at a time.
There is no way to add multiple products at once.
I suggest to add support for multiple addition in at least in the form of comma separated products.
Also I find out there is no way to set sticker to show percentage value of discount if product has discount in the form of price amount.
I want also to suggest to add such an option because the seller wants to discount product by its amount of price but wants to show to customer percentage amount of discount instead of fixed discount amount.
Another problem occurs when you set up 2 or more sitckers in the same position (for ex. in top left corner).
They overlaps themself even if I set up different value in position field in configuration. Please resolve this issue because setting up Y offset on every stickers is tiring and unintuitive.Thanks for your feedback, they are valuable for us.
1. I got you. The process wouldn’t be pleasant if you need to add a stick to 50 different products. But I can’t find a better way.
Listing all products out is definitely not a solution.
Entering comma separated product ids is not okay for some people.I will consider adding an input field for people to add comma separated product ids, to have two ways available.

What do you think?Hi, Below are my answers regarding your post:
1. If you think that separating products via comma or other delimiter isn’t very convenient you can suggest other solution. For that problem I came up with idea to make a modal window with list of all products with basic infos (name, reference, maybe thumbnail, price etc.) and checkboxes to check which one will have sticker.
2. Thanks for posting me a workaround. I managed to resolve this issue by myself but I thought about suggesting to you to make that changes as an option in configuration.
3. About showing multiple stickers in the same position: In my opinion from every solution posted by you the b) example resolves the problem. As for the gaps between stickers: It can be done just with setting margins around them of course allowing user to set up size of the margins.
Entire solution could be accomplished by allowing to place stickers to same position as long as it doesn’t overlap to next position (for ex. image is 12 stickers height, it has 3 positions in entire height so it can allow to set at most the 4 stickers in the same position, another stickers setted up to same position just won’t be displayed).1. That’s not a good idea to list all products out. The solution must be one that can work on all sites. Listing all products out is not a solution for sites with thousands of products. I will add a field for comma separated product ids if no better solution.
3. I insist that using x and y is better. It’s not supposed to put too many stickers on the image. Above the product name is a good place to put stickers.3. With X and Y offset I’m unable to insert second sticker in place of first if first get disabled.
Assume that scenario:
I set up “New” sticker as first and “Discount” sticker as second with Y offser for products. If product will stop being “new” the “Discount” sticker will still be in the same position but I wanted to place it on the position of “New” sticker.
So the stickers should push next stickers in same position to go down (left, right or whatever direction, configurable in backend).- AuthorPosts
